Purpose
The project aims to build capacity and knowledge, increase international engagement, and build professional and circumpolar connections of Canadian Arctic and Northern youth to up to 180 youth through participation to Arctic Frontiers, Emerging Leader and Alumni programs; (1) The Arctic Frontiers conference focuses on building the bridge between science, policy, business across communities and generations. Arctic and Northern Canadian youth participants have an opportunity to share their perspectives on Arctic issues and experiences to a broad range of Arctic stakeholders, and gain experience in public speaking in a professional setting. (2) The Emerging Leaders program is an early-career mentorship and capacity-building program for young professionals from academic, industry and policy sectors and will provide opportunities for skills and leadership training, knowledge exchange and networking. The program is an immersive 7-day experience, which includes a five-day journey throughout the Norwegian Arctic and two days at the Arctic Frontiers conference in Tromsø. The project contributes to 15 Arctic and Northern Canadian youth to participate to the program. (3) The project develops the Alumni Network to facilitate communication and cooperation amongst the international network of Emerging Leaders alumni. This Network allows for participants from the Emerging Leaders to continue engagement and build upon their experience. The Network provides opportunities for professional, intellectual, and social interaction with other alumni, including with those in remote communities. The Alumni Network hosts virtual bi-annual meetings to identify strategic initiatives, and leadership workshops to build capacity.
